One of the most versatile and effective dry fly patterns available and usually the answer of the often-asked question “if you could only fish one dry fly, what would it be?” Its effectiveness comes from a very realistic silhouette that sits low in the water and the highly visible wing that is known to be trigger for trout to eat. The highly visible wing is also in part responsible for its popularity among anglers. The calftail wing and parachute-style hackle also add floatation.
